You are stuck with a M42 with the 1995.
You are also "stuck" with OBD 1.

Actually I think M42 and OBD1 are better than M44 and OBD2

You can chip your M42 engine for additional horsepower (some say 20 or so). I may soon try that out.
Also, be aware that some late 1995 M42 engines use the M44 oil filter form 1996+. These have a plastic cover instead of the metal one.
